  19. Vitamins in bulk and taken as artificial supplements are rarely the answer. Vitamins and minerals need others to be absorbed properly and to do their jobs (I'm keeping this simple). Most of what you need you will get from a good diet but there would probably be no harm in taking a multivitamin supplement if your diet is/has been lacking. No vitamin will stop an infection. They are just chemicals that help our cells regerenate and keep our bodies in optimum condition to maintain health and fight infection.
